چکیده مقاله:

Currently sustainable development approach is regarded as an integrated framework that enables long term planning and management with minimum threats to the environment. In the arid and semi-arid climate of Iran where the impacts of climate change along rapid population growth and industrialization briskly affect the limited water resources, sustainability-oriented approaches can be used to develop water management scenarios. On the other hand, the emerging need for enhanced urban green spaces, due to their valuable services and functions, necessitate allocating sufficient water resources for irrigation and maintenance of urban green infrastructure. Regarding scarce water resources, corresponding supply and demand scenarios should be investigated. Since groundwater is the principal water resources that is generally used for green spaces in many urban areas across centralIran, this paper focuses on introducing criteria that can define sustainable abstraction from groundwater resources. However, in cases of severe climatic situations when adequate amount of water cannot be used for green spaces, it is necessary to prioritize the green spaces within urban areas for water allocation. This paper also suggests developing indices for urban areas and valuing green spaces. Hence, the joint use of quantified water resources and urban indices leads to developing decision making scenarios which can be scored and rated in order to choose the most appropriate scenario.
